First, find the circumference of the wheel using
You know that your diameter is 24. To find the radius, divide the diameter by 2, which is 12.
Input 12 as r and simplify. ->
estimate your Pi as 3.14
and multiply. C=75.36
Now you know the distance of one full revolution in inches. To find 200 revolutions, multiply that answer by 200.
75.36 * 200 = 15,072 inches
But because this is in inches, you have to find the answer in feet, so just divide that answer by 12.
15,072 / 12 = 1,256 ft
Rick bought 5 pounds of steak.
Step-by-step explanation:
Given,
Cost per pound of steak = 13.50
Cost per pound of chicken = 3.25
Total bought = 8 pounds
Total paid = 77.25
Let,
x represents the pounds of steak purchased
y represents the pounds of chicken purchased
According to given statement;
x+y=8 Eqn 1
13.50x+3.25y=77.25 Eqn 2
Multiplying Eqn 1 by 3.25
Subtracting Eqn 3 from Eqn 2
Dividing both sides by 10.25
Rick bought 5 pounds of steak.
